y=|x−3|+|x+2|−|x−5|, if x>5

Answer:

Y= x+4

Step-by-step explanation:

hello :

Y=(x−3)+(x+2)−(x−5), if x>5 because : (x-3)  , (x+2)  ,(x-5) are positifs

Y= x-3+x+2-x+5

Y= x+4
